vivo X70 Pro

Strengths

The Vivo X70 Pro has a premium and rather compact design, making it easy to wield.
It features an excellent battery life, with an endurance rating of 123 hours.
The phone's curved AMOLED screen is great, with fast refresh rate and HDR10+ support.
The camera setup is impressive for a mid-ranger, featuring a gimbal stabilized 50MP main cam and two telephotos.
Low light photos from the main cam are really good, with impressive dynamic range and contrast.
The phone's price offers great value for its features, especially when it comes to still photography.

Weaknesses

The Vivo X70 Pro doesn't have waterproofing, unlike the pro plus model which is IP68 rated.
It lacks stereo speakers, with a single speaker that earns only a 'good' score on loudness chart.
The phone uses a Mediatek Dimensity C1200 chipset, rather than a flagship-grade Snapdragon 888.
Video recording quality is disappointing, even at 4K resolution and 60fps.
Selfies from the 32MP front-facing cam are soft and noisy.
Night mode doesn't provide much benefit for the telephoto cameras, and can even make photos less sharp.

Xiaomi Redmi Note 11S 5G

The Xiaomi Redmi Note 11S 5G is a budget mid-ranger that shares similarities with other Redmi Note 11 phones. Its design, while sleek, doesn't particularly stand out, resembling the Poco M4 Pro 5G more than its own lineage. The camera bump, however, does make a statement. The phone's display is a 6.6-inch IPS LCD with a 1080p resolution and fast 90Hz refresh rate, providing smooth scrolling and swiping. However, it lacks deep blacks and HDR support, and max brightness is average at around 420 nits. Storage is expandable via microSD, but the phone's battery life is one of its redeeming qualities, rivaling the Poco M4 Pro 5G with a 5,000mAh power cell. The Mediatek Dimensity 810 chipset provides decent performance for everyday tasks, but it lags behind current rivals in CPU and GPU tests. The camera setup features a 50MP main cam, an 8MP ultra-wide cam, and a 2MP macro cam. Daytime photos are solid with good color rendition and detail, while night mode improves dynamic range significantly. However, low-light performance is inconsistent, and ultra-wide shots lack detail in low light. Selfies, on the other hand, are impressive with plenty of detail and pleasing colors. Video recording maxes out at 1080p resolution, with decent dynamic range but soft footage from both cameras. The Redmi Note 11S 5G's price is attractive, but it's hard to get excited about a phone that doesn't bring anything new to the table. It's essentially the same as last year's Poco M4 Pro 5G, and competitors have since improved upon its specs. While it's a solid budget mid-ranger, it's not particularly memorable.

vivo X70 Pro

The Vivo X70 Pro is a premium mid-ranger that offers impressive camera capabilities, a nice display, and excellent battery life. The phone's design feels compact and lightweight, with a frosted glass-like finish on the back. However, it lacks waterproofing and has only a single speaker compared to the flagship model. The 6.56-inch AMOLED display is curved and features a fast 120Hz refresh rate, making for smooth scrolling and swiping experience. The screen also supports HDR10+ and content looks great with excellent color accuracy. The phone's battery life is impressive, with an endurance rating of 123 hours, outlasting the flagship model. One of the standout features of the Vivo X70 Pro is its camera setup. It has a gimbal-stabilized 50MP main camera, two telephotos (12MP and 8MP), and a 12MP ultra-wide-angle camera. The phone's camera performance is impressive, with great details and punchy colors in both bright and low-light conditions. However, the Vivo X70 Pro falls short in some areas, such as audio quality, which lacks depth and bass. Additionally, the chipset is not flagship-grade, but still provides high-level performance. Overall, the phone's camera capabilities and battery life make it a great option for those looking for a mid-ranger with excellent photography features at an affordable price. The Vivo X70 Pro may not be perfect, but its strengths in design, display, and camera capabilities make it worth considering for those who prioritize these aspects over other features.
